    With a few clear days it’s the time of year to get into the garden to tidy up some of those tired looking plants and scruffy borders. A consequence of this is that the garden starts to look a little bare so plans are afoot to introduce some ornamental grasses. Not only will these add a little life and movement to the garden over the winter months but a number of them, like miscanthus sinensis, will provide shelter and seeds for the birds. These can be cut back towards the end of winter before the new shoots start to come through.
